Synthesis and elucidation of deuterated vanillylamine hydrochloride and capsaicin
Kim, Sang Wook,Park, Jeong Hoon,Jung, Soon Jae,Choi, Tae Bum,Hur, Min Goo,Yang, Seung Dae,Yu, Kook Hyun
experimental part, p. 563 - 565 (2010/07/02)
Capsaicin is the major pungent component of hot peppers, which belong to the plant genus Capsicum. Although the biosynthesis of capsaicin is known to involve the condensation of vanillylamine and 8-methylnonenoic acid by capsaicin synthase, the mechanism of biosynthesis is still not fully understood. In this study, deuterium labelled versions of capsaicin and the precursor vanillylamine were synthesized in order to investigate the biosynthesis of capsaicin in hot peppers. Copyright
